A Semester Abroad in Scotland: Maeve Burns

Maeve visiting Edinburgh city.

I studied abroad in Dundee, Scotland for a spring semester and I cannot recommend it enough. Everyone is friendly and welcoming; my professors even took the exchange students out to dinner multiple times throughout the semester. Scotland has a very lively culture along with many hiking and camping opportunities. As students we could take the buses for free, which allowed for easy day trips to all of the major cities. It was also cheap and easy to travel around the rest of Europe on weekends and during spring break.

Even though I am a math student, I took accounting classes when I was there because their math classes did not line up the same way they do at NC State. All the professors I had at the University of Dundee were great. They were very passionate about the classes they were teaching and made sure everyone could succeed. Overall, the experience was 10/10 and everyone should do it!
